The red carpet was rolled out—literally—for Tabernacle’s third graders as they arrived for the first day of End-of-Grade (EOG) testing! With a high-energy “Showtime” theme, our incredible third grade teachers transformed the hallway into a Hollywood-style celebration to motivate and encourage students.

Each student’s name was proudly displayed on a gold star, lining the red carpet to let them know they are the real stars of the show. From the moment students walked in, the atmosphere was filled with cheers, music, and movement. Teachers led a fun dance session to help students shake off any test-day jitters and start the day with confidence and smiles.

It was a morning full of encouragement, celebration, and community spirit—setting the stage for student success. Way to shine, third grade!
